拆模
代码是浇筑时的模板,AI把模板拆了,剩下的才是建筑本身
链上漂流 的文章由 AI 写作引擎 Prose Kit 生成。
混凝土浇筑完成之后要等。
等多久取决于天气、配比、构件的受力类型。普通楼板,七天。梁,十四天。悬臂结构,二十八天。不能急。养护期没到就拆模板,混凝土会开裂,或者直接塌。
我爸年轻时在县城做过几年工地。他跟我说过一句话:模板比楼值钱。
我没听懂。他解释说,一栋六层的住宅楼,模板费占土建成本的三分之一。钢模板一套几十万,木模板便宜但用三次就得换。工人工资里有一半花在支模和拆模上。支模的时候,水平要用水准仪找,垂直要用线锤吊,接缝要用海绵条塞,每一块板子的位置精度在两毫米以内。
浇完混凝土,等它硬了,拆模。拆下来的模板运走,清理,涂脱模剂,下一栋楼接着用。
模板从来都只是模板。建筑成形之后,它就该走了。
2025年有一段时间我在看一个论坛。Hacker News。程序员的聚集地。那段时间每隔三天就有一个帖子,标题大同小异:AI会取代程序员吗。
评论区永远分两拨。一拨说不会,AI写的代码是垃圾,不能用于生产环境。另一拨说会,三年之内初级程序员岗位清零。
两拨人都在谈模板。没人在谈建筑。
老陆在杭州做了九年Android开发。2024年底被裁。他跟我说这事的时候在吃面,一碗片儿川,他把雪菜全挑到一边。
他说:我会的东西很具体。Java,Kotlin,Jetpack Compose,Gradle构建,内存泄漏排查,ANR优化。你在招聘网站上搜这些词,2023年还有三页结果,2025年半页。
我说:你在找什么方向。
他说:我不找了。
他把手机递给我看。屏幕上是一个App的界面,看着像是给餐饮店用的。排班表,库存表,日报表,还有一个营业额曲线图。
他说:我丈母娘在萧山开了一家面馆。三十个座位。她管账用的是一个硬皮本子,圆珠笔写的,每天晚上关门之后坐那儿算。我看了一眼那个本子,差点没忍住。进货没有日期,只有金额,还有一栏写着”小张拿走的”。
他说:我用Cursor加Claude,三天写了这个。我一行Kotlin都没写。全是TypeScript。我不会TypeScript。
我说:那你写了什么。
他停了一下。
他说:我写了需求。哪些数字丈母娘需要看,哪些不需要。进货怎么分类她能记住,怎么分类她记不住。报表是按天看还是按周看。她不识字多少,按钮上只能放图标。这些东西AI不知道。这些东西得我去面馆蹲两个礼拜才知道。
1906年,辛辛那提有一个人叫托马斯·爱迪生。跟发明灯泡的那个没关系。Thomas Edison of Cincinnati,当时报纸这么叫他,因为他发明了一种可以拆卸和重复使用的钢模板系统。
在他之前,美国的混凝土建筑用木模板。每栋楼的模板都是现场做的,用完就扔。工人得会木工、会看图、会校准、会养护。模板手艺占了混凝土施工成本和时间的一大半。
钢模板改变了这件事。标准化的面板,螺栓连接,可以拆了装,装了拆。模板不再是一门手艺,变成了一套工具。会看图就行了。
木模板工人慌了。他们的手艺花了十年练出来,现在一个新人学两天就能上手。工会抗议过。报纸上有记录。他们的诉求是:限制钢模板的使用,保护木模板工人的岗位。
没人听。因为建筑商算了一笔账:用钢模板,同样一栋楼,工期缩短40%,成本降三分之一。
木模板工人里,有一部分人转行了。他们发现自己真正值钱的本事不在手指上。在脑子里。看图纸、理解结构、知道哪里受力大哪里可以省,这些东西跟模板材料无关。钢模板来了之后,他们不需要再花60%的时间在锯木头和钉钉子上。他们开始做施工管理、结构设计、质量监理。
另一部分人的全部手艺就是锯得直、钉得准。模板一换,他们什么都不剩。
我后来见过老陆两次。第一次是2025年10月。他丈母娘的面馆App改了三版了,加了供应商对账和员工考勤。萧山那片有四家面馆在用。他没收钱。他说先让人用着。
第二次是2026年1月。他注册了公司。公司名字我就不说了。员工两个人,他和他老婆。他老婆管销售,就是挨家挨户去餐饮店聊天。他管产品,就是听完之后回来跟AI说要改什么。
他的客户全是小餐饮店。十到五十个座位那种。夫妻店,或者雇两三个人的。他说大店不要,大店有钱用专业的ERP系统,美团也在做。他只做那些大系统看不上的。
我说:你现在写代码吗。
他说:我每天大概花两个小时跟AI对话,让它改功能、修bug。剩下的时间我在外面跑。去店里坐着,看老板怎么算账,看服务员怎么记单,看后厨怎么盘库存。
他说:以前在公司的时候,产品经理给我一个文档,我写代码实现。我从来不去想这个功能有没有人用,用起来顺不顺手,解决的到底是不是真问题。我不需要想。有人替我想。
他说:现在没人替我想了。
他说这句话的时候带了一点什么。不像开心,也不像抱怨。像是一个人第一次不戴眼镜看东西,有点晕,有点亮。
混凝土里有一个概念叫强度等级。C20,C30,C40,数字越大强度越高。C30的意思是28天标准养护之后,试块的抗压强度不低于30兆帕。
强度这个词听起来像是混凝土天生带着的。其实得在模板里成形、在时间里养护之后才长出来。同一批混凝土,倒在地上,散了,什么形状也没有,强度无从谈起。灌进模板里,约束住,等它内部的水化反应完成,拆模,站住了。
模板给了它形状。时间给了它强度。但模板不是它。
我在想程序员这件事的时候,脑子里反复出现这个画面。
一个人花十年学代码。语法、框架、调试技巧、系统设计模式、性能优化手段。这些东西像模板,严丝合缝地把他约束成一个特定的形状。Java工程师。iOS开发者。全栈程序员。标签很清楚,边界很硬。
十年之后,他内部的水化反应其实已经完成了。他对软件怎么解决问题这件事有了自己的判断力。什么需求是真的,什么需求是伪的。架构该简单还是该复杂。哪些功能用户真的会用,哪些是产品经理的自嗨。这些东西不在代码里。在代码旁边。在写代码的过程中不知不觉长出来的。
AI来了,相当于拆模。模板被抽走了。
有些人站住了。他们发现自己是一栋楼。混凝土已经硬了,结构完整,自己撑着自己。模板拆了正好。以前被模板挡住的立面终于露出来了。
有些人塌了。模板拆了,里面是散的。跟聪明没关系。养护期还没到。或者,灌进去的东西从一开始就是水泥浆,没有骨料,没有钢筋,没有那些在模板里看不见的东西。
建筑工程里有一个词叫过早拆模。
养护期没到就拆,混凝土强度不够,构件会变形甚至垮塌。桥梁工程里出过事故,原因就是为了赶工期提前拆了模板,梁在自重下开裂了。
我想起Hacker News上一个帖子,标题大意是:我是一个刚毕业的CS学生,我觉得我不需要学编程了,我可以直接用AI。
评论区最高赞的回复就两个字:Good luck。
一个人花两年学编程,有一天发现AI可以帮他写代码了。这叫工具升级。一个人一天编程都没学过,直接让AI写。这叫过早拆模。
区别在于里面有没有东西。
老陆用AI做出丈母娘的面馆App,AI只是施工队。真正撑着这个App的,是他九年Android开发攒下来的东西。他知道一个App的后端该怎么组织数据,他知道用户操作流程里哪里会卡,他知道一个bug描述里哪些信息是有用的、哪些是噪音。这些判断力是在他写了九年代码的模板里养出来的。模板拆了,判断力还在。
他只是从一个写代码的人变成了一个知道该写什么代码的人。
2025年下半年,市面上突然多了一大批独立开发者做的小产品。SaaS工具、效率App、垂直行业小系统。很多是程序员做的。
大部分死了。
我问老陆怎么看。他想了一下,说了一句很准的话。
他说:他们在做程序员觉得应该存在的产品。用户需要什么,他们没去问过。
他说:我去丈母娘面馆蹲了两个礼拜。头三天我列了二十个功能。后来砍到五个。因为她根本不需要那些。她需要的是:今天进了多少货,花了多少钱,卖了多少碗,赚了多少。一张纸能写下来的东西。只是她的纸太乱了,我帮她理了一下。
他说:AI能帮你把任何想法变成代码。问题是你的想法从哪来。如果你的想法来自你自己的脑子,来自你蹲在现场看到的东西,那AI就是你的施工队。如果你的想法来自别的程序员做了什么、Product Hunt上什么火了、Twitter上谁融了资,那AI就是帮你更快地浇一栋没人要的楼。
我想说一件关于模板的事。
混凝土建筑有一个阶段叫带模养护。模板不拆,让混凝土在里面慢慢硬。模板在这个阶段的作用不只是给形状。它还保水。混凝土的水化反应需要水。模板裹在外面,减少水分蒸发,让反应充分进行。
拆早了,表面失水,会起粉、开裂。
这跟学编程一样。你在公司里写三年CRUD,觉得无聊,觉得浪费生命。但那三年你泡在一个环境里,每天被需求文档、代码审查、线上事故、同事的骂、用户的投诉包裹着。这些东西就是水。你的判断力在里面慢慢发生反应。
你以为你在搬砖。你其实在养护。
我最后一次见老陆是上个月。他的小餐饮管理系统已经有三百多家店在用了。他说他刚谈了一个事,有个做餐饮供应链的公司想收购他的产品,出价不高,但附带一份技术顾问的合同。
他说他在考虑。
我问他:你现在觉得自己是什么。
他喝了口茶,说:我是一个懂软件的餐饮人。或者一个懂餐饮的软件人。我也不知道。反正我不是Android开发了。
他顿了一下。
他说:我以前觉得写代码是目的。后来发现写代码是模板。目的是模板里面那个东西。模板拆了我才看见。
窗外有个工地在浇筑。搅拌车的滚筒一圈一圈转着。模板立得整整齐齐。
过几天就该拆了。